We’re heading towards our COVID Normal!

We’ve all heard The Premier talk about reaching our ‘COVID Normal’ and we’re getting so close to this milestone. Only one more step to go!  

Following recent confirmation about our capacity limits, we’ve decided that from Monday 30th November, you will no longer need to pre-book to visit the gym and aquatic areas at PARC! Group Exercise classes will remain on the booking system as it was pre-COVID.  

This update coincides with us reactivating all Complete and Aquatic memberships, meaning members get more flexibility and can return to the Centre to enjoy our programs and facilities in a COVID-safe environment.

How are we keeping you COVID-safe? 

Your health and safety within our facility is still our first priority, so even though capacity is significantly increasing, we will still maintain our stringent COVID protocols and terms of entry:

Face masks must be worn in Centre unless out of breath exercising, entering the pool or a medical exemption.
Contact details will be taken upon entry, either via your PARC band through the turnstile or a QR code to sign in
Social distancing is required throughout the Centre regardless of location you must stay 1.5 meters away from other patrons
COVID Marshalls and PARC staff will be monitoring and enforcing all terms of entry throughout the building
Hand sanitising is encouraged as you enter and exit each area of the facility
Cleaning equipment after use is essential with the disinfectant wipes provided 
Bring your own towel and water bottle as there is no drinking fountains available

Important Centre Update:  Main Pool Hall Closure 
Thursday 31 July, back open on Monday 18 August

Please be advised that the entire Main Pool Hall will be closed from Thursday 31 July to Monday 18 August to allow for essential, unplanned boiler replacement works. During this period, there will also be no hot water to the showers Centre-wide. 

One of the most important systems in our facility is the boiler system, which heats our pools and showers. Unfortunately, we recently experienced an unexpected fault that impacted heating water. As a result, we’re fast-tracking a major replacement to this critical system to restore full comfort and ensure long-term reliability. To safely complete these works, the entire Main Pool Hall will be closed from Thursday 31 July to Monday 18 August.

The Warm Water Pool and Spa remain operating as normal.
